AASA, ܲAVƵ, today announced the launch of its new District Services, a comprehensive and customizable portfolio designed to help public school systems bring their community’s vision for student success to life.
This marks the first time in AASA’s history that the association will offer a full suite of direct, hands-on consulting and design services to school districts — a milestone made possible through its recent strategic integration with Battelle for Kids, a nonprofit known for its innovative work in Portrait of a Graduate design and community engagement.
“For nearly 160 years, ܲAVƵhas supported school system leaders through professional learning, advocacy and thought leadership,” said David R. Schuler, executive director of AASA. “Now we can now go even further—helping districts and communities design, align, and implement the systems that create greater opportunities and pathways for every student, in every community.”
AASA’s District Services team meets districts where they are — from defining a shared vision to implementing strategy and measuring impact. Solutions and services include:
- Portrait of a Graduate
- Community Compass
- Strategic Planning
- Branding & Communications
- Roadmap
- Portraits of Educators
- Frameworks for Learning
- Learning Experience Accelerator for Teachers
- Measure What matters
- Impact Showcases
Each service is designed around AASA’s belief that public education is a public promise — one that requires local collaboration, courageous leadership, and strategic alignment.

AASA, ܲAVƵ, founded in 1865, is the professional organization for more than 13,000 educational leaders in the United States and throughout the world. AASA’s mission is to support and develop effective school system
leaders who are dedicated to equitable access for all students to the highest quality public education. For more information, visit www.aasa.org.
